The invention belongs to the technical field of new energy, and particularly relates to a movable energy storage charging pile which comprises a vehicle body frame, hub motor wheels used for driving the vehicle body frame to move are arranged at the bottom of the vehicle body frame, and an infrared collection camera used for controlling the vehicle body frame to move is arranged at the top of the vehicle body frame. A first limiting plate is arranged at the top of the vehicle body frame, a second limiting plate is arranged at the bottom of the vehicle body frame, a first anti-collision shell is arranged between the first limiting plate and the second limiting plate, a plurality of air springs are arranged between the vehicle body frame and the first anti-collision shell, and an air compression set and an air tank are arranged in the vehicle body frame. The air tank is communicated with each air spring through a distribution valve, and an air pressure sensor is arranged on each air spring. According to the invention, the battery of the charging pile can be quickly replaced, so that the working time of the charging pile is prolonged, and meanwhile, regional scheduling of energy is facilitated.
